Output 254317608e8380d423c77df34258722226ca4f0345163baa70178c9724b99398:2

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ddc638f7835cd97d5ad0b094856a68ee8110813 OP_EQUAL
address
A5NMxKxKFg6f8PyqXaJ1xAkTTiQyH9ea9V
transaction
254317608e8380d423c77df34258722226ca4f0345163baa70178c9724b99398